What Causes a Musty Smell in My Basement?
A musty basement smell is mold and bacteria growing on damp material and releasing gases as they feed. The moisture behind it comes from one of four places: humid summer air condensing on cool walls and floors, groundwater pushing in through the foundation, a bare-dirt crawl space connected to the basement, or a slow leak from plumbing or an HVAC condensate line. Find and stop the water source and the smell goes away on its own. Run a dehumidifier without doing that and you are just paying to slow it down.
I have been under a lot of Atlanta houses. The musty basement calls cluster in July and August, and about half the time the homeowner tells me they had already tried opening the windows down there to air it out. In Georgia, in August, that makes it worse. More on why in a second.
What affects how bad the smell gets
| What drives it | What that looks like at your house | Effect on the smell and the fix |
|---|---|---|
| Summer dew point vs. wall temperature | Outdoor air in the upper 60s to low 70s dew point, basement walls and slab sitting near 62 to 68 degrees | The single biggest seasonal driver here. Smell peaks June through September, drops off in October. Usually solved with sealing plus a dedicated dehumidifier |
| Roof water landing at the foundation | Downspouts dumping within a few feet of the wall, negative grading, clogged gutters | Cheapest thing on this list to correct and it fixes a surprising number of "wet basement" calls. Skip it and every other repair works harder |
| What is under the connected crawl space | Bare Georgia clay, torn plastic, or a proper sealed liner | Bare dirt can push gallons of water vapor a day into the house. Big swing in both smell intensity and repair scope |
| Groundwater and soil | Red clay holds water against the wall after storms; seepage at the cove joint where the wall meets the slab | Puts you into drainage work: interior French drain and a sump. Larger job, and the only real fix when water is actually entering |
| Foundation cracks | Hairline vertical cracks that darken after rain, white chalky efflorescence | Crack injection is quick and targeted. Left alone it keeps wetting the same corner |
| Organic material stored down there | Cardboard boxes, old carpet pad, fallen fiberglass batts, framing lumber | Mold needs food. Wet cardboard is the best food in your house. Removing it can cut the odor fast |
| Mechanical leaks | Sweating supply lines, clogged AC condensate drain, dryer vented into the crawl space | Small source, constant supply. Often the cause when the smell never changes with the weather |
| How long it has been wet | Months vs. years | Under a few months you are cleaning and drying. Past a year or two, wood moisture content stays above 20 percent and decay fungi start eating joists, which turns an odor call into a structural repair |
The smell itself tells you something
What you are smelling are microbial volatile organic compounds. Geosmin is the earthy, fresh-turned-dirt one. 1-octen-3-ol is the mushroom note. Your nose picks these up at very low concentrations, which is why a basement can smell obviously wrong while looking totally dry.
Two smells get confused with musty and are not the same problem. Sewer gas is sharp and sulfur-heavy, and it usually means a floor drain P-trap dried out. Pour a cup of water down it. If the smell clears in a day, that was it. A sweet, chemical, almost fruity smell near HVAC equipment is worth a call to your HVAC company instead of me.
Why summer is worse, and why opening a window backfires
Air holds water based on its temperature. When 74-degree dew point air from an Atlanta August afternoon hits a foundation wall that has been sitting at 64 degrees since spring, the water comes out of the air and onto the wall. Same reason a glass of sweet tea sweats on the porch.
So the vent-it-out instinct is exactly backward down here from June through September. You are feeding the wall. I have walked into Decatur basements where the homeowner had a box fan pointed at an open window and the joists above it were the wettest wood in the house.
Once relative humidity stays above roughly 70 percent, mold has what it needs. It does not need standing water. That is the part that surprises people whose basement floor has been dry all year.
Where the water is actually getting in
Through the wall and the cove joint. After a heavy storm, clay soil around the foundation stays saturated and pushes water toward the lowest opening. In poured walls that is often a hairline crack. In block walls the cores fill and it weeps out at the joint where the wall meets the floor. The tell is a damp band a few inches up the wall, or white chalky mineral residue.
Up from the crawl space next door. A lot of Atlanta houses on sloped lots are part basement, part crawl space, especially the 1950s and 60s ranches around Chamblee, Smyrna, and East Point. The finished side gets the attention and the dirt side gets a door closed on it. Warm air rises and leaves the top of the house, and replacement air gets pulled in from the lowest point, so crawl space air ends up in your hallway. You smell the crawl space upstairs before you ever see a problem downstairs.
From something you own. Cardboard, old carpet and pad, and fiberglass batts that fell off the joists and are lying face-down in the dirt. All of it holds water and feeds growth. Same for a dryer vent that terminates in the crawl space instead of outside, which is one of the more common things I find and one of the easiest to correct.
How I sort out which one you have
Before quoting anything I want three readings and one wait.
A hygrometer left in the space for a few days, not a single spot check. A pinless moisture meter on the band joist, the sill, and two or three floor joists, because wood tells the truth about the last several months even when the air is dry today. And a look outside at where every downspout ends and which way the dirt slopes in the first ten feet from the wall.
Then I want to know what it does after rain. If the smell spikes a day after a storm and fades, that is bulk water and you need drainage. If it is steady all summer and calms down in the fall, that is vapor and air, and drainage would be an expensive answer to the wrong question. If it never changes at all, we go looking for a leak.
What actually fixes it, in order
- Get roof water away from the house. Extend downspouts, clear the gutters, correct grading. Do this first because everything downstream depends on it.
- Stop bulk water entry. Crack injection where cracks are the path. Interior French drain to a sump where groundwater is coming in at the joint.
- Seal the ground and the vents. A properly detailed liner sealed to the walls and columns, with vents closed off, cuts the vapor supply.
- Control the air that is left. A dedicated crawl space dehumidifier draining to daylight or a pump, not a plug-in unit from a big-box store with a bucket somebody has to empty.
- Take out what is already contaminated. Wet insulation goes. Cardboard goes. Surface growth on framing gets treated and cleaned rather than painted over.
A note on the cheap version, because I get asked: a roll of plastic thrown loose over the dirt is not encapsulation. It traps water underneath, gets walked on and torn by the next tech under there, and does nothing about the vents or the air. I have pulled out plenty of it, and pulling it out and doing the job right costs more than doing it right the first time. If the price you were quoted feels too easy, ask what happens at the wall line and at the vents.

When musty is telling you about structure
Wood that stays above 20 percent moisture content long enough gets soft. Then the floor above it starts to feel bouncy, doors stick, and you find a joist you can push a screwdriver into. At that point the odor was the early warning and the repair is structural: replacing damaged framing, adding a drop girder to carry a sagging span, setting interior steel columns to bring a floor back to level, or carbon-fiber straps on a foundation wall that has started to bow.

About cost
I am not going to put a number in a blog post, because the honest range depends on square footage, how much water is coming in, and whether any framing has to be replaced. What I will tell you is the shape of it. Downspout and grading work is the cheap end and you may not need me for it. Sealing the ground and adding dehumidification is the middle. Drainage with a sump, plus sealing, plus structural repair is the top. You get a written, itemized number after somebody has actually been under your house, not over the phone.
